Output 3b5301542682fb3e0dd8470c105c594d27e05c5f835d41320ed82133141517c7:5

value
995998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1ef753b51468e75ff5e433d27690a10da78191 OP_EQUAL
address
3Bdzg1whiHd91hgesZ65HHDuybbrf3eJpD
transaction
3b5301542682fb3e0dd8470c105c594d27e05c5f835d41320ed82133141517c7
spent
true